About Taşkın Yücel
Taşkın Yücel is a scholar working on Surgery, Otorhinolaryngology, Epidemiology,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Physiology, having authored 16 papers that have together received 494 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pituitary Gland Disorders and Treatments (4 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(3 papers), Sinusitis and nasal conditions (3 papers), Meningioma and schwannoma management (3 papers), Head and Neck Surgical Oncology (3 papers),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(2 papers), Drug-Induced Adverse Reactions (2 papers) and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(332 citations), Otorhinolaryngology (66 citations), Surgery (280 citations), Epidemiology (202 citations) and Immunology and Allergy (28 citations). Taşkın Yücel has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and United Arab Emirates. Frequent co-authors include Mustafa Berker, Alper Gürlek, Derya Burcu Hazer, Metin Önerci, M. Mustafa Aldur, Ayşenur Cila, Dilek Berker, Serdar Güler, Serhat Işık and İlkay Işıkay. Their work appears in journals such as Surgical Innovation, Experimental and Molecular Pathology, Acta Neurochirurgica, Pituitary and Head & Neck.
